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Playa Del Rey Short-term Studio Apartments | $3,009 | $1,650 | $8,095 |
Playa Del Rey Short-term 1 Bedroom Apartments | $3,369 | $1,133 | $8,491 |
Playa Del Rey Short-term 2 Bedroom Apartments | $4,264 | $1,900 | $10,000+ |
Playa Del Rey Short-term 3 Bedroom Apartments | $5,199 | $2,175 | $10,000+ |
Playa Del Rey Short-term 4 Bedroom Apartments | $4,361 | $1,875 | $10,000+ |

The neighborhood of Playa Del Rey, CA has become a popular location for individuals and families of all ages. Of course, one of the biggest reasons why people decide to live in the local area has to do with the weather. It doesn't get too hot or too cold in Playa Del Rey, CA, meaning that virtually all activities in the local area remain open throughout the year. Second, the neighborhood has a very strong school system. That makes the area a great place to raise a family. Finally, there is also a vibrant job market in Playa Del Rey, CA as well, making it's easier for people to support their families.á
